The COD of the effluent from the aeration tank is unstable

2016-07-18View Original

Thread Content

The COD level in the effluent from our anaerobic tank is 60–160 mg/L, while it’s around 18–30 mg/L in the effluent from the aeration tank; sometimes it even reaches 40 mg/L. Why is there such a large variation in the COD levels of the effluent from the aeration tank? We would like to keep this level around 25 mg/L, with minimal fluctuations. Are there any methods to achieve this?
Reply #22016-07-18
If the COD of the incoming water varies greatly, then the COD of the anaerobic and aerobic effluents will also vary significantly. In the initial stage of a new tank, it is necessary to cultivate bacteria; therefore, the COD of the incoming water must be kept stable. A large tank can be used for this purpose. If the COD of the incoming water is too high, fresh water, river water, or aerobic effluent can be used to adjust it, while if it is too low, nitrogen and phosphorus should be added.
